Four years from Shellys breath taking experience, she is back in it with her new team. After raiding the White House and taking down the Vice President, she makes a new discovery that puts yet another Target on her head. She not only has one possession but two that the government wants. Figure out how she takes on this new challenge and read this amazing sequel to The Key.
